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chacoan Peccary | Imperial Webcap |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(hayvan) | Fungi (mantar)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Kordalılar) | Basidiomycota (Bazitli mantarlar) |
| Class | Mammalia (memeliler) |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Çift toynaklılar) | Agaricales (Lamelli mantarlar) |
| Family | Tayassuidae | Cortinariaceae |
| Genus | Catagonus | Cortinarius |
| Species | Catagonus wagneri | Cortinarius purpureus |
